For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 388 students in Laurel School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Mississippi.
Public Middle Schools in Laurel School District have an average math proficiency score of 22% (versus the Mississippi public middle school average of 50%), and reading proficiency score of 22% (versus the 39%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Mississippi public middle school average of 54% (majority Black).

Laurel School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 147 school districts in Mississippi (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 82% has increased from 75-79%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$15,294 is higher than the state median of $12,408. The school district revenue/student has grown by 19%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$11,896 is less than the state median of $12,276. The school district spending/student has grown by 9% over four school years.
